An exciting opportunity has arisen within the Radiotherapy/Oncology department for a motivated and enthusiastic ChemoCare IT support officer to join the team.
The Cancer Centre based at The James Cook University Hospital serves a population of just over a million and benefits from being at the heart of one of the largest acute trusts in the country. All major services are present on the one site giving the department excellent support in all aspects of medicine, surgery and diagnostic services.
The Teesside and North Yorkshire area has seen significant investment into oncology services alongside an expansion of consultant numbers. The £35M oncology Endeavour unit at The James Cook University Hospital was opened in April 2012 and the Robert Ogden Cancer centre in Northallerton in 2018. The department boasts an expanded chemotherapy unit designed to meet the increasing demand for systemic treatment and state of the art radiotherapy facilities. There are also dedicated out-patient departments and offices. The department has used the ChemoCare electronic prescribing system for a number of years and has encouraged and established nurse-led and pharmacy-led chemotherapy clinics.
Main duties of the job
The post holder will support the development and maintenance of the Electronic Chemotherapy prescribing system (ChemoCare). We are looking for candidates with the ability to quickly build and develop strong relationships to support the Hospital Trusts in the ChemoCare system Hub and Spoke model.
The post holder will support the development, modification, and maintenance of ChemoCare. This will include assisting all Hospital Trusts within the ChemoCare Hub and Spoke model on the day-to-day operational needs and liaising with external suppliers.
The post holder will be required to develop performance activity statistical reports (using CRYSTAL reports) and provide information to the Chemotherapy management team.
The post holder will be required to deliver appropriate training and support to Pharmacy, Nursing teams, junior doctors, consultants and administration staff.
There will be a requirement to travel between hospital sites to support the Chemotherapy Electronic Prescribing System. Also flexibility to work out of hours or an occasional weekend, to carry out various routine tasks such as the SACT reporting data uploads.
The ideal candidate will be educated to Degree level or an equivalent professional qualification in a computer related discipline. Excellent problem solving and communication skills are essential.
